Rebel shot dead in Aceh skirmish

BANDA ACEH, Aceh: An alleged member of the separatist Free Aceh Movement (GAM) was shot dead during an armed skirmish with a joint patrol in Buloh Blang Ara village, North Aceh, on Tuesday, police said on Wednesday.

Muhammad Jafar, 40, was killed in the clash that ensued after GAM members threw a grenade at security forces on patrol in the area, North Aceh Police chief Supt. Abadan Bangko said.

"We seized a grenade, six AK-47 bullets, a walkie-talkie and a map after the attack," he said.

Locals, however, said Jafar was shot by security officers in front of his house during a search in which three people were arrested. Jafar's body reportedly was claimed by his family for burial later in the day.

The GAM commander in North Aceh, Abu Sofyan Daud, said Jafar was not a member of the organization. (50/edt)
